Sandra Ferreira is a scholar working on Industrial and Manufacturing Engineering, Strategy and Management and Building and Construction. According to data from OpenAlex, Sandra Ferreira has authored 12 papers receiving a total of 473 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 9 papers in Industrial and Manufacturing Engineering, 6 papers in Strategy and Management and 3 papers in Building and Construction. Recurrent topics in Sandra Ferreira's work include Municipal Solid Waste Management (9 papers), Sustainable Supply Chain Management (5 papers) and Recycling and Waste Management Techniques (4 papers). Sandra Ferreira is often cited by papers focused on Municipal Solid Waste Management (9 papers), Sustainable Supply Chain Management (5 papers) and Recycling and Waste Management Techniques (4 papers). Sandra Ferreira collaborates with scholars based in Portugal, United Kingdom and Belgium. Sandra Ferreira's co-authors include Rui Cunha Marques, Nuno F. da Cruz, Pedro Simões, Simon De Jaeger, Mario Grosso and Lucia Rigamonti and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Cleaner Production, Waste Management and Resources Conservation and Recycling.
